Excerpt from The Controversy Between Sir Richard Scrope and Sir Robert Grosvenor, Vol. 2: In the Court of Chivalry, A. D. MCCCLXXXV-MCCCXC; Containting a History of the Family of Scrope, and Biographical Notices of the Deponents The Second Volume is complete, with the exception of the Title-page. It contains a History of the House of Scrope down to the reign of Henry the Fourth, including Memoirs of every Member of it who was mentioned by the Deponents in 1386; and is accompanied by Pedigrees of the two great branches of Bolton and Masham. The History of the Scrope Family is followed by Biographical Notices of upwards of two hundred of the Deponents in favour of Sir Richard Scrope, with translations of the material parts of their depositions.
